没有合适的资源?快使用搜索试试~ 我知道了~
java8集合源码-KidozChallenge:Kidoz挑战
共9个文件
java:3个
png:2个
mf:1个
需积分: 9 0 下载量 42 浏览量
2021-06-04
17:17:10
上传
评论
收藏 268KB ZIP 举报
温馨提示
java8集合源码Kidoz挑战 使用Java8 EJB Project解决了这个挑战。 给定的打字稿代码转换为简单BonusVacation.java 优化的类是VacationDays.java 给定代码中需要修复的问题: 1.向所有员工异步发送电子邮件鉴于问题同步发送电子邮件但异步发送电子邮件异步消息的优点: 它们实现了灵活性并提供了更高的可用性——系统对信息采取行动或以某种方式立即响应的压力较小。 此外,一个系统停机不会影响另一个系统。 在我们的案例中 - 您发送了数千封电子邮件,而无需员工回复您。 所以在这种情况下我们也可以忽略 ack 的即时感。 2.使用Java LocalDate计算员工工作年限LocalDate 的优点可读性: Calendar.getInstance() 的命名不是很好:如果不阅读 Javadoc,很难判断您正在获取哪个实例。 LocalTime.now() 是非常自我描述的:你有时间,现在就是现在。 要偏移日期,您可以调用偏移方法 (plus),而使用 Calendar API,您必须手动更改对象的字段(在此示例中为小时),这很容易出错。 易用性(
资源推荐
资源详情
资源评论
收起资源包目录
KidozChallenge-master.zip (9个子文件)
KidozChallenge-master
ExecutionTime_BeforeOptimization_108ms.PNG 147KB
VacationKidoz
.project 828B
ejbModule
META-INF
MANIFEST.MF 36B
com
kidoz
vacationbonus
BonusVacation.java 4KB
VacationDays.java 7KB
EmailApi.java 986B
.gitignore 278B
README.md 3KB
ExecutionTime_AfterOptimization_19ms.PNG 143KB
共 9 条
- 1
资源评论
weixin_38722721
- 粉丝: 5
- 资源: 928
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功